Andy Murray vs. Mikhail Youzhny: Score and Recap from Cincinnati Masters 2013

Alex KayJun 4, 2018

Andy Murray defeated Mikhail Youzhny 6-2, 6-3 in the second round of the 2013 Western & Southern Open in Cincinnati on Wednesday.

Murray made his first appearance of the tournament against the 31-year-old Russian, as the No. 2 seed was given a bye in the first round. It was a rematch of their fourth-round battle at Wimbledon last month.

Murray didn’t play at his absolute best, but he certainly performed better than he did coming off an extended break last week. The world No. 2-ranked player notably lost in straight sets to Ernests Gulbis in the third round of the Rogers Cup last Thursday.

After taking nearly a month off following an epic victory at the 2013 Wimbledon Championships, it wasn’t surprising to see Murray struggle a bit in Montreal, but there will be no excuses if he fails at the Cincinnati Masters this weekend.

Youzhny made it easy for the Scot superstar to advance to the third round, committing 41 unforced errors over two sets and exiting in just over an hour of playing time.   

Murray advances to face Julien Benneteau in the next round and seems to be on a collision course to face Roger Federer in the semifinals. Neither opponent is likely to play as poorly as Youzhny, so Murray must step his game up or once again face a possible early elimination.

Novak Djokovic, the player he ousted in the SW19 finals, is lurking on the other side of the bracket and is likely eyeing a rematch with Murray in this event.

After becoming the first Brit to win at All England Club in 77 years, Murray must not rest on his laurels. He needs to take care of business leading up to the 2013 U.S. Open and prepare to defend his title later this month in New York.

The 26-year-old won his first Grand Slam title at Arthur Ashe Stadium, following an unforgettable gold-medal performance in the 2012 London Olympic Games.

If Murray’s going to continue his excellent 2013 campaign and win a second major tournament, he’ll need to step up and prove he’s ready by winning the Western & Southern Open.
